Abstract
This paper is composed of two parts: theoretical and experimental. The theoretical part is divided into several sections. The main character istic properties of 3d (transition metals) and 4f (rare-earth metals) magnetism are explained in the second section. The properties of rare- earth-transition metal compounds are discussed in the third section, p articularly with respect to applications. The fourth section is devote d to the rapidly growing field of magnetic thin films. Specific proper ties of ultra-thin films and multilayers are summarized. In the experi mental part the original magnetic properties of sandwich films, consis ting of a soft amorphous Co-Zr layer placed between two Sm-Co layers w ith different coercivities, are reported.
